mirror of
https://github.com/reactos/reactos.git
synced 2025-08-03 20:56:26 +00:00
[RTL]
Comment out RtlAcquirePrivilege & RtlReleasePrivilege for the moment. It appears we are overflowing memory and thus corrupting registry, that breaks ReactOS install. To be investigated... svn path=/trunk/; revision=58938
This commit is contained in:
parent
d4c38c2fe4
commit
d41a8557a3
1 changed files with 9 additions and 0 deletions
|
@ -112,6 +112,7 @@ RtlAcquirePrivilege(IN PULONG Privilege,
|
||||||
IN ULONG Flags,
|
IN ULONG Flags,
|
||||||
OUT PVOID *ReturnedState)
|
OUT PVOID *ReturnedState)
|
||||||
{
|
{
|
||||||
|
#if 0
|
||||||
NTSTATUS Status;
|
NTSTATUS Status;
|
||||||
PRTL_ACQUIRE_STATE State;
|
PRTL_ACQUIRE_STATE State;
|
||||||
ULONG ReturnLength, i, OldSize;
|
ULONG ReturnLength, i, OldSize;
|
||||||
|
@ -344,6 +345,10 @@ Cleanup:
|
||||||
RtlFreeHeap(RtlGetProcessHeap(), 0, State);
|
RtlFreeHeap(RtlGetProcessHeap(), 0, State);
|
||||||
|
|
||||||
return Status;
|
return Status;
|
||||||
|
#else
|
||||||
|
UNIMPLEMENTED;
|
||||||
|
return STATUS_NOT_IMPLEMENTED;
|
||||||
|
#endif
|
||||||
}
|
}
|
||||||
|
|
||||||
/*
|
/*
|
||||||
|
@ -353,6 +358,7 @@ VOID
|
||||||
NTAPI
|
NTAPI
|
||||||
RtlReleasePrivilege(IN PVOID ReturnedState)
|
RtlReleasePrivilege(IN PVOID ReturnedState)
|
||||||
{
|
{
|
||||||
|
#if 0
|
||||||
NTSTATUS Status;
|
NTSTATUS Status;
|
||||||
PRTL_ACQUIRE_STATE State = (PRTL_ACQUIRE_STATE)ReturnedState;
|
PRTL_ACQUIRE_STATE State = (PRTL_ACQUIRE_STATE)ReturnedState;
|
||||||
|
|
||||||
|
@ -388,6 +394,9 @@ RtlReleasePrivilege(IN PVOID ReturnedState)
|
||||||
/* Release token and free state */
|
/* Release token and free state */
|
||||||
ZwClose(State->Token);
|
ZwClose(State->Token);
|
||||||
RtlFreeHeap(RtlGetProcessHeap(), 0, State);
|
RtlFreeHeap(RtlGetProcessHeap(), 0, State);
|
||||||
|
#else
|
||||||
|
UNIMPLEMENTED;
|
||||||
|
#endif
|
||||||
}
|
}
|
||||||
|
|
||||||
/*
|
/*
|
||||||
|
|
Loading…
Add table
Add a link
Reference in a new issue